Output e8c41b936a6ea999187d45206a85b5a4ef46994fcb31e2261cb11e2a241b39cf:14

value
2903988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a169266b375d6151c881512346fbb8a96376e44 OP_EQUAL
address
3Fjm2QaW4VkUbjRmXijqExgj1qEgdCHKgy
transaction
e8c41b936a6ea999187d45206a85b5a4ef46994fcb31e2261cb11e2a241b39cf
spent
true